Top place to see in Samoa

Samoa is a beautiful country with a rich cultural history. It is also known for its lush, green islands and warm weather. It has been named as one of the best countries to visit in the world by CNN and Lonely Planet.
The best time to visit Samoa is from November to April, when the weather is warm and sunny. The rainy season starts in May and ends in October, which makes it a perfect time to go on an island tour or hike through the country's many volcanic mountains.
The main attractions of Samoa are its beautiful beaches, its scenic views, and its people who are incredibly friendly.
